First try: One cup Cinnamon Roll
Taste : I've never really tried the real cinnamon roll. So it was quite new, the taste of cinnamon 🤤...loved it . Though the dough was a bit crumbling I overcooked it by 5min @ 180°C.
Tastes a bit similar to meethe khurme with cinnamon dust lol idk how else to compare
Next I'm gonna try the full pan!

u/Mean_Respond7097 2d ago
For the one cup cin roll, my dough ended up quite greasy so had to add double the initial flour ;)
Also cuz the measurements were in tbsp and tsp...I prefer grams scale ðŸ«
I just changed the frosting to milk and sugar one instead of cream cheese. (Used gpt for the frosting recipe cuz I didn't have cream cheese)
